Trinity College Library Dublin, Fuji X-T2 50mm F2 at F2 1/170sec ISO12800, not gone through the rest of my card properly yet, but this one surprised me as the Fuji seems brilliant with anything green, but to get the detail in this one at a level I couldn't even see with my eyes, it was pretty dim in there.
Ps.. it's got locking buttons on the ISO and shutter dials, but they just seem to unlock themselves, never had that problem with Nikon, but still its a lovely camera
he Fuji seems brilliant with anything green
Interesting you say that because reproducing 'green' is what the Bayer Array is specifically designed to do well. It's what a lot of digital sensors do badly (compared to film) and is the colour the human eye is most sensitive to (which is why we notice when green is poorly rendered).
Oh with one caveat, Lightroom/Adobe camera RAW totally murders Fuji RAW files when it comes to green, as soon as you start any sharpening, only a touch and I mean a touch and you get weird wormy type artifacts in the greens. I pre-process using Irident X-Transformer and apply the camera/lens profile in that before Lightoom, then all I do in Lightroom then usually is a straighten to cope with my cack handiness.

As a magazine designer I'd have cropped in slightly tighter and lost white space from the left, or run a title and text down that area.
The way you are leaning to the right distances yourself from that space on the left, but to my eye there isn't enough white or too much. As a landscape crop it would work better for me.

I had the opportunity to practise making formal 'studio' style portraits with a fascinating and very fine young man called Callun. He's a parkour practiioner and a very good one. He's only 18 but he runs a local community project teaching and coaching kid in parkour. What he's acheived is to be admired.
Anyway, he's been looking to do some TV work and I offered to help him create a portfolio of headshots (for free). He needs the shots, I need the practise so it was a win/win.
I've not really done anything like this before. In truth I was simply setting up in my living room with a white sheet pinned across an alcove as a backdrop, so it's all still quite limited but it was an interesting exercise and I like some of the results:
